Education, logic, and puzzle systems, methods, and techniques
11123631 · 2021-09-21 · ·

New and unique puzzle mechanics, systems, and methods are described herein. A puzzle grid comprising linearly arranged intersecting words, with each individual letter placed on a separate puzzle tile, may be divided into a plurality of puzzle pieces, where each puzzle piece is formed of one or more contiguous puzzle tiles. Each puzzle piece shape conforms to one of a predefined set of shapes. To mix up the puzzle grid, identically shaped puzzle pieces may be randomly shuffled and rotated if required so that the puzzle layout remains unchanged whereas the letters are scrambled. Also puzzle pieces whose shape exhibit rotational symmetry may be optionally rotated within the puzzle layout. Letters may maintain upright legibility. A user may then attempt to solve the puzzle by swapping identically shaped puzzle pieces and optionally rotating puzzle pieces whose shape exhibit rotational symmetry.

Financial method and apparatus
11043140 · 2021-06-22 ·

An apparatus, method, and/or system for teaching the value of monetary coins including first, second, third, and fourth bases, each having a plurality of recesses, and first, second, third and fourth inserts, each having at least one protrusion for inserting into a corresponding recess of one or more of the first, second, third, and fourth bases. The first, second, third, and fourth bases may be provided in one kit or as part of one overall apparatus, wherein the first base has only one hundred recesses, the second base has only twenty-five recesses, the third base has only ten recesses, and the fourth base has only five recesses. The first, second, third, and fourth inserts may be configured to cover twenty-five, ten, five, and one recesses, respectively to represent twenty five cents, ten cents, five cents, and one cent of a U.S. dollar.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S TO ENHANCE AND DEVELOP NEW GAMES AND ACTIVITIES BASED ON LOGIC PUZZLES
20210197070 · 2021-07-01 ·

Methods and apparatus of associating by a computerized system, labels with the order of execution of steps of solving a puzzle, game or activity, for one or more parts of one or more solution-paths for the puzzle, game or activity are described. Execution of the puzzle solution and also the particular sequence of steps in the solution paths are used to evaluate a relative efficiency of one sequence of steps over the other sequence. By quantifying efficiency of the solution path it becomes possible to logically and objectively compare the efficiency of two or more solutions or completions of the puzzle, game or activity.

Neuro Puzzles
20210170266 · 2021-06-10 ·

An alternative to a traditional single solution puzzle is disclosed. Under the puzzle system of the present invention, each tab fits into each pocket, thereby allowing the user to build creatively rather than attempt to solve. The puzzle system of the present invention is useful for all, and it is optimal for young children, aging and cognitively impaired adults.

GAME BOARD AND METHODS AND SYSTEMS FOR PROVIDING AN ENTERTAINING EXPERIENCE OF WAR BETWEEN THE PLAYERS OVER A PLURALITY OF AREAS OF A GAME BOARD
20210154565 · 2021-05-27 ·

Disclosed is a system and method for providing an entertaining experience of war between players over a plurality of areas of a game board. The game board includes a plurality of areas, which may be depicted as a world map, a plurality of board playing cards, and connectors, where the connector makes adjacent a first board playing card of a first playing area with a second board playing card of a second playing area. Each player is delt a plurality of holding cards including the suit assigned to that specific player. The objective of the game is for players to alternate swap requests, swapping holding cards with board playing cards until a player accumulates a winning hand including a straight flush. The defined areas and connectors on the game board increases the interaction and frequency of battles between players making it more difficult to accumulate a winning hand.

Systems and methods for determining game level attributes based on player skill level prior to game play in the level
10987589 · 2021-04-27 · ·

A system, a machine-readable storage medium storing instructions, and a computer-implemented method are described herein for a System Tuner for customizing a player's experience. The System Tuner calculates a player skill level for a player. The System Tuner modifies at least one attribute of a second game level based on the player skill level prior to game play of the player in the second game level. The System Tuner detects game play of the player in the second game level. The System Tuner identifies a difference between a current rate of progression of the player and a reference rate of progression. The System Tuner triggers the modified attribute of the second game according to an extent of the difference between the current rate of progression and the reference rate of progression.

Crossword puzzle generator

Methods and systems that facilitate generating and presenting a crossword puzzle. Methods include obtaining, from a content source, a plurality of data items. Using the plurality of data items, a dictionary of clue-word pairs are generated. A crossword layout is generated using a random crossword layout generator. The generated crossword layout is input to a model that outputs a likelihood that the input crossword layout results in a valid crossword. If the likelihood that the crossword layout results in a valid crossword puzzle satisfies a first threshold, a plurality of words in a set of clue-word pairs from among the plurality of clue-word pairs is inserted into the crossword layout. If the plurality of words inserted into the crossword layout results in a valid crossword puzzle, the crossword puzzle is provided to a user on a user device using the set of clue-word pairs.
